Tender Description

This tender invites bids for the installation of a 03 kW solar power system at the Golarchi/S.F.Rahu Court in Badin, issued by the District and Sessions Court, Badin. The procurement falls under the Power, Electrical & Solar Equipment category, reflecting the need for renewable energy solutions in the judicial complex. The project involves supplying and installing a hybrid solar system including a 3 kW Inverex Nitrox inverter, seven 580W Tier-1 MonoPERC solar panels, a lithium-ion battery bank, and all necessary framing, wiring, and electrical components. The installation site is located in Badin, where the system must be robust enough to withstand local weather conditions, including wind speeds up to 150 km/h. The scope covers testing, commissioning, and handover, ensuring a fully operational solar power setup. Bidders should ensure compliance with relevant PEC categories and maintain valid FBR/ATL registration for the fiscal year 2025-26. The tender requires submission of a bid security of PKR 36,133 in the form of a bank draft or pay order. The bid validity and earnest money must remain effective for 90 days from the bid opening date. Performance guarantees of 2% of the bid price are also mandatory, retained until satisfactory completion and warranty periods. The submission deadline is set for 10:50 AM on 12th February 2026, with technical bids opening at 11:00 AM the same day via the SPPRA e-Procurement (ePAD) system. Bidders must submit their proposals electronically, and the original bid security instrument must reach the procuring agency before bid opening. The physical venue for bid opening is the Conference Hall of the Judicial Complex, Badin.
